そのため、Red Hat 6以降、FC-SANへの異なるパス間でロードバランシングを行うための3つのアルゴリズム、デフォルトのダムラウンドロビン(および新しい)キューの長さとサービス時間から選択できることを学びました。
マルチバス構成でpath_selectorのさまざまな値のパフォーマンス比較を長い間探していましたが、実際の経験に基づいて情報を見つけることができませんでした。何がどの状況でより良く機能するかという仮定すら見つかりませんでした。
この質問に対して実際のパフォーマンステストを行った人はいますか?または私が見つけることができなかったリソースに関する情報?
キューの長さを使用するサーバーがいくつかありますが、問題はありません。ただし、一般的に、マルチパスに関して最適化することはあまりありません。私たちは今でも大多数のサーバーに基本的なラウンドロビンを使用しています。これはよく知られたセットアップであり、未知のリスクはほとんどなく、少なくとも私の店では、キューまたはサービス時間ベースのマルチパスのパフォーマンスの向上はわずかです。
対処しようとしている特定の問題がありますか?それとも、可能な限りセットアップされていることを確認しているだけですか?
その間に、私はいくつかのテストを行いましたが、違いは実際にはわずかです。
round-robin queue-length service-time
Write char KB/sec 872 884 876
Write block KB/sec 327345 331218 330533
Rewrite KB/sec 144384 144102 141393
Read char KB/sec 3714 3900 3485
Read block KB/sec 363308 349765 360518
Random Seeks count/sec 19 18
私はext4-ファイルシステムでbonnie ++を使用しました。